Island View Endurance Run
The Island View Endurance Run is an endurance trail running event hosted by the Santa Barbara County Trails Council on the Gaviota Coast in California. The event takes place October 24 and 25, 2026, with the start area at the Baron Ranch Trailhead near Goleta, located on Calle Real between Santa Barbara and Buellton. Routes run through Los Padres National Forest and the Santa Ynez Mountains and include sections to Gaviota Peak, ridgelines, and canyons.
The course surface is a mix of ranch roads and single-track trails through chaparral and coastal riparian zones in a Mediterranean climate. The routes include multiple climbs and descents, ridge runs with ocean and valley views, and varied terrain across foothills and crest. Elevation gain varies by distance, for example the 100-mile course lists 24,059 feet of climb while the 100-kilometer course lists 15,994 feet.
Distance options include:
- 100 miles
- 100 kilometers
- 50 kilometers
- 25 kilometers
- 12 kilometers
Entry fees listed for main distances are $350 for the 100-mile entry, $250 for the 100-kilometer entry, $150 for the 50-kilometer entry, and $75 for the 25-kilometer entry. Some race services noted by the organizer include official race shirts, aid stations (varies by distance), race photos, EMT support, and finish-line food and water. Proceeds support trail maintenance in Santa Barbara County.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
